Output 8505630cc91871d00af5c528b3a20649d1ad13bf5ae4ce802c5e7fb5764dbb75:0

value
84000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5e67a0aa3b47f2d0f2edb18338eef5ecd74d30 OP_EQUALVERIFY OP_CHECKSIG
address
12DgsrXk6QcWjdUfW4XBqK9NBdn12RtFdR
transaction
8505630cc91871d00af5c528b3a20649d1ad13bf5ae4ce802c5e7fb5764dbb75
spent
true